(Jojack) #7

Just use a load out with the Empire 9 as the secondary. If you’ve played as proxy with the Hoschfir, or have played that gun as any other merc (not sure who has access to it), the Empire 9 is almost identical in every stat, just slightly worse. The main thing it falls short is on clip size, but it’s not that it’s got a small clip. The Hoschfir just has a huge clip. I use the Empire as primary and the Aunuld as a one shot finisher either after taking them low with stickies or the Empire.

(capriciousParsely) #10

My favorite class atm. Got a bronze card for him with unshakable, drilled, and double time. With this comes the Hollunds and the Simeon revolver. And I’m having so much fun. Just running around, never stopping, bombing people and finishing them off with the shotgun. If I don’t succeed with the shotgun or they step too far away, just take out the revolver and finish anyone in 1-2 shots. The revolvers on fast characters are really under appreciated. Headshotting with those is lethal. It’s really easy to whittle down Rhinos with the revolver at range since the damage dropoff is really really low.

The Uzi comes in different variants. Some are machine pistols, some are SMGs and others are neither. The MAC-10 is strictly a machine pistol, unless you count state compliant modifications that make them semi-automatic pistols. The only MAC-10s that would be considered SMGs are after-market modifications. There are also clones that are produced as SMGs. As for the CZ Scorpion, it is only produced as a SMG as well as a semi-automatic pistol as a legal loophole. As for the Empire-9, it is a MP9 and that is strictly a machine pistol. There is also a variant that is a semi-automatic pistol and like most machine pistols, you can modify them into SMGs. Do remember we are talking about English classifications. Some languages do not differentiate between machine pistols and SMGs. The Russians, for example, use to consider anything that automatically shot pistol cartridges as machine pistols.
